So a fluorescent light bulb spends 16 times less energy towards heat production compared to a convection heater. These room heaters generally run at around 1500 watts. To give you an idea of how hot that could make a room, I would like to compare it to an average convection heater. So a 100 Watt fluorescent light/bulb would spend around 90 Watt towards generating heat. While incandescent light is only 1.9% efficient, fluorescent light can use as much as 10% of the energy towards producing light. ![]() The rest of this article answers other important questions regarding fluorescent lights like how much heat they generate, how they compare to other lights like LED, and whether they are relatively cost-efficient.įluorescent light is four times cooler than the incandescent (traditional yellow) lamps. ![]() Therefore, rooms with fluorescent lighting do not get as hot as rooms with conventional light bulbs. Because of traditional light bulbs, light is associated with heat, and people buying fluorescent lights may wonder if they also give off heat as well as what kind of heat they can expect fluorescent lights to generate.įluorescent lights give off heat, but it is considerably less than traditional light sources like incandescent bulbs because of higher efficiency and lower resistance.
